The phrase "actions of administrators"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the behaviors, decisions, or activities performed by individuals in administrative roles.
Example: "The actions of administrators during the crisis were crucial in maintaining order and ensuring safety."
Alternatives: "conduct of administrators" or "deeds of administrators".
